Lynx3d <lynx.mw+...@gmail.com> changed: What |Removed |Added 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- Status|NEEDSINFO |CONFIRMED Resolution|WAITINGFORINFO |--- CC| |lynx.mw+...@gmail.com Ever confirmed|0 |1 --- Comment #6 from Lynx3d <lynx.mw+...@gmail.com> --- I'm seeing this issue here too with LCMS "fast float" plugin on (K)Ubuntu 20.04. Interestingly, 16 bits/channel images don't seem to be affected, for those soft proofing to grey/alpha and CMYK works fine for me. Unchecking "Allow Little CMS optimizations" in Color Management settings (and relaunching Krita) does not make a difference here either, but I haven't checked yet if that setting even affects soft proofing... Neither does disabling vector optimization fix the issue, which is the only place I can think of right now where we might violate strict aliasing rules. In any case, I'd also say it is that very issue Wolthera filed for LittleCMS.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
